The Eagle has landed: Rioli rejoins West Coast, set to return to training – AFL
Willie Rioli will be back training with West Coast after being spared a conviction over drug possession

PREMIERSHIP forward Willie Rioli has returned to Perth as he prepares to make a move back into life as a West Coast player.
Rioli has been given the tick of approval to rejoin the Eagles after his latest off-field indiscretion where he pleaded guilty to cannabis possession in Darwin.
Part of the Eagles’ decision to welcome the 2018 flag winner back will come with strict conditions and support mechanisms that have been ticked off by the AFL Players Association.
